    The sample schemas are intended to allow practicing and exercising specific features of the database. The purpose of each schema is described in the 'Oracle® Database Sample Schemas' manual for your database version at http://tahiti.oracle.com. (See 'Master Book list' or 'All books'.)
    Many of the examples of `how to use a feature`using these schemas will be found in the documentation (http://tahiti.oracle.com) related to the feature. For example, base queries will be found in the SQL Language Reference manual. Spatial features will be found in the Spatial Users Referrence manual. And so on.
    Other than that, many of the samples found at htp://otn.oracle.com > Sample Code assume that the samples are installed.
    Oracle university database language courses also assume the schemas are loaded. However, their sample code is not available for obvious reasons.
    In all cases the samples are not performance oriented examples, simply because Oracle's cost-based optimizer can not provide consistent performance if size or statistics change.

    To drop SCOTT schema, run the batch file/shell script:
    ORACLE_HOME\BIN\DEMODROP
    To drop HR schema, run SQL script:
    ORACLE_HOME\DEMO\SCHEMA\HUMAN_RESOURCES\HR_DROP.SQL
    There are a number of other sample schema scripts to drop the other schemas installed with Oracle9i. If you can't find them easily, read the Sample Schema Guide on http://tahiti.oracle.com/.

    The Order Entry (OE) schema builds on the purely relational Human Relations (HR) schema with some object-relational and object-oriented features. The OE schema contains seven tables: Customers, Product_Descriptions, Product_Information, Order_Items, Orders, Inventories, and Warehouses. The OE schema has links into the HR schema and PM schema. This schema also has synonyms defined on HR objects to make access transparent to users.

    There shouldn't be a need to install any packages. They should come preinstalled already.
    If not, you can find them here:
    C:\oraclexe\app\oracle\product\10.2.0\server\RDBMS\ADMIN
    Just be very careful before trying to install something into the data dictionary. If you are not experienced, you might mess up your database.
    For example, utl_file is installed but invisible to most users, e.g. HR.
